Lillie Langtry’s Victorian Christmas Show - Friday, December 12, 2008

7:30 p.m. Tickets $12.00 Please come and celebrate a Victorian Christmas and feel the magic of the holiday season with Miss Lillie Langtry and her daughter Jeanne Marie. The evening will be filled with music and story. Lillie Langtry was born in the Channel Island of Jersey in 1853. She married Edward Langtry 1874. She became the mistress of the Prince Edward, Queen Victoria's oldest son. Her daughter was born 1881. She became a stage actress when Mr. Langtry went bankrupt. There will be Christmas Carols, Broadway tunes and some contemporary songs. You will enjoy the humor of Miss Lillie as she invites some of the audience to sing and dance with her. Miss Lillie will be portrayed by Lucille Fala-Brennan, New York -born actress/vocalist. Jeanne Marie will be portrayed by Stephanie Mau of Summit Hill. Come join us for a fun and memorable evening.

Lew Achenbach and Lance Rautzhan-both Schuylkill County native artist- will show new art work at the SCCA Galleries this Sunday, November 9th, 2008.

Meet the artists reception is from 2pm-4pm.

Achenbach & Rautzhan have a non representational painting style that will excite your imagination.

Lew Achenbach: "The act of painting is a dialogue that I have with the surface; a call and response. The process is facilitating the work to unfold into it’s proper form. It starts as a solid automatic writing pocket of actuality. A memory, a channeled expulsion, a tug at purity and singularity. Currently, I try ‘not’ to paint in a representational way. Attempting to harness an essence of (non) subject. The high challenge is to maintain the honesty of the initial mark-making, as the work proceeds. Colors ‘ask’ to be next to one another; layered and passing on the surface. A story proceeds with color marks, slashes and logical moves. The work tells me that it is finished (for now), or that I’ve gone that one stroke too far (moving that particular piece into another phase of treatment; a chastising or salvaging. A return to prime with sculptured paint ridges (underneath). I purge found surfaces to work on, from the streets of NY and SF, to discarded planks surrounding my PA studio. Burnt wood, stones, ancestral tools all play essential parts in a completed piece : as pattern makers, derived designs and symbols of influence. Revisiting past works has come to fruition. Example : a river flood altered paint sketches in the studio and have been reworked accordingly. Water lines and smudges have become ‘work from’ points; a collaboration. Entities, ancient writing and animal formations are manifest. I am not concerned with making anything beautiful at this point. Something genuine and real is motive."

Lance Rautzhan: "The bastard child of Hans Hoffman and Stan Lee, Lance Rautzhan’s work draws on the passion and improvisational bravado of the New York School and bridges the gap to a Pop aesthetic that reveals an intimate exploration of the human condition. Continuing his characteristic exploration of a more structured Abstract Expressionist influence, Rautzhan’s new paintings are infused with rich and vibrant color fields littered with elements of screen printing, drip painting, figuration and text. These paintings investigate the consequences of love, loss and living in New York City. Lance was influenced by the fantastic imagery of comic book and album cover art of the 1970’s. Forgoing art school to study social theory at Indiana University of Pennsylvania, he continued to create and study art under his own conditions and on his own terms. After relocating to Baltimore from New York in 1999, Rautzhan began painting prolifically and exhibiting heavily in Baltimore and eventually in New York. His work is included in the collections of individuals, businesses and galleries throughout the US and in Europe."

Mean Girls – Movie Hosted by Schuylkill County VISION November 16, 2008 – 2:00 p.m. Tickets: $2.00

Mean Girls is a 2004 American teen comedy film, based on the novel, Queen Bees and Wannabes, directed by Mark Waters and starring Lindsay Lohan. Written by (and co-starring) Tina Fey, the film features a supporting cast of Rachel McAdams, Amanda Seyfried, Lacey Chabert, and Lizzy Caplan. The film also features several Saturday Night Live cast members, including Fey, Tim Meadows, Ana Gasteyer, and Amy Poehler. Mean Girls has been praised as being Lohan's break-out film role.
